WebGCF of 4, 6, and 12 = 2 What is the Greatest Common Factor? Put simply, the GCF of a set of whole numbers is the largest positive integer (i.e whole number and not a decimal) that divides evenly into all of the numbers in the set. It's also commonly known as: Greatest Common Denominator (GCD) Highest Common Factor (HCF) WebThe GCF is the largest common positive integer that divides all the numbers (4,6,12) without a remainder. WebSep 8, 2014 · What is the H.C.F of 8 and 12? To find the HCF of 8 and 12, first write them as the product of their prime factors: 8 = 2x2x2 12 = 2x2x3 The next step is to identify any common prime factors. In this example, both numbers have two 2s as prime factors. Multiply these together and you get 4. Thus the HCF of 8 and 12 is 4.
